You might also want to try deleting your browser cookies for BioMart. The issue 
was probably a session that exists in one server is not found on the other.

If you have more than one server it's a good idea to enable stickiness in your 
load balancer (HAProxy or mod_proxy_balancer for Apache). This will forward 
traffic for the same user to the same server, which will get around the session 
problem.

When I try to use openID to log into your site I get a popup in my browser that 
warns about the traffic being switched from HTTPS to HTTP, which leads me to 
believe there is a problem with the http.url and https.url settings in your 
biomart.properties file. You should set these to the real external URLs of your 
site if they aren't already set to that. You also should set your http.host to 
'0.0.0.0'.




When I try to login with yahoo instead of openid, I get redirected to the 
following URL on successful login:

http://localhost:9000/

which is what the default settings would be if they weren't changed.
